I've had Comme des Garcon perfumes on my wishlist for a while. I finally got samplers of the 4 I like the sounds of. First up is Blue Encens.

Notes:
Artemisia, Frozen Spices (Indian Cardamon, Black Pepper, Cinnamon), Incense, Mineral Amber Crystals.

 

Definitely smells like a scent for men. It smells good. Not something I'd wear, but something I'd like to smell on a guy. Maybe. The pepper is kind of strong.

Perfume no. 40: Marc Jacobs Divine Decadence from my Play box. @Sjofna since you asked about this one, here are my thoughts.

 

Boy, does this one have a life cycle. I don't think I've ever smelled a perfume that went through that many transformations. At first, it smelled citrusy, fresh, bright like Commodity Tea. Then the vanilla took over, and it smelled like one of the fragrances from Juicy Couture, though I can't think of which one exactly. Viva La Juicy? The Rosé one? Not sure. After that, it started smelling like dessert, like YSL Mon Paris minus the berries (that particular perfume makes me smell like a berry tart all day). Then, an hour later, the perfume starts to fade quite a bit, and I'm left with a faint vanilla scent with a touch of citrus similar to Atelier Vanille Incensee.

 

Notes:
Champagne Extract, Orange Blossom, Creamy Bergamot, Gardenia, Hydrangea, Honeysuckle, Saffron, Vanilla, Liquid Amber.

Defíneme Audry: I haven't heard anything about this brand, but I had an Ulta GC and it was my anniversary week plus 5x the points for fragrance so I thought I'd try it out. Alas, not a fan of Audry, even though the notes are right up my alley. It is both aggressive and boring at the same time. It is a very generic floral with a cheap soap base that just gets worse with time, and I get no sandalwood at all. About the only good thing I could say is that it has decent longevity (unfortunately) 😛 now I'm scared to try anything else from this line. 

 

Notes: peony, rose, jasmine, sandalwood
